High current DC micro-ohmmeter

Description

RMO600 is a micro-ohmmeter based on state of the art technology, using the most advanced switch mode technique available today. The micro-ohmmeter RMO600 generates true DC current with automatically regulated test ramps. During the test the micro-ohmmeter ramps with increasing current before measuring and decreasing current after the measurement. This eliminates magnetic transients.
After the test current has been set, the automatic test procedure is started by pressing the Ω-button.
The micro-ohmmeter can store up to 500 measurements. All measurements are time and date stamped. Using RMOWin-V2 software a test can be performed from a PC, and the results can be obtained directly at a PC. Using RMOWin-V2 the result can be arranged as an Excel spreadsheet which can be later shown as a diagram and printed for a report.
The set is equipped with thermal and overcurrent protection. The micro-ohmmeter has very high ability to cancel electrostatic and electromagnetic interference in HV electric fields. It is achieved by very efficient filtration. The filtration is made utilizing proprietary hardware and software.

Output Ratings

The full output is available from the micro-ohmmeter at 230V or 115V Mains Supply.

Supply Voltage Output Current Full Load Voltage
230V AC 600A DC smoothed 5,0V DC
  300A DC smoothed 6,0V DC
115V AC 600A DC smoothed 3,0V DC
  300A DC smoothed 5,0V DC

Output current is filtered and has a ripple of less then 1%. The microhmmeter current output is rated at 600A for 30 seconds, at 300A for 2 minutes and 200A continuously at 25°C ambient.

CONT Mode

The micro-ohmmeter RMO600 can generate DC current continuously using the CONT menu. In this menu the current can be chosen the same way like in the SINGLE menu, but the duration of the test can be preset. The test is started pressing the Ω-button. During the test, a new result is shown on the display and stored into the PC (RMOWin-V2) each second. Connecting a Test Object to micro-ohmmeter RMO600

Connecting a Test Object to micro-ohmmeter





With the micro-ohmmeter RMO600 turned off, connect the instrument to the test object (Rx) in such a way that the measuring cables from the "Voltage Sense" sockets are attached as close as possible to Rx, and in between the current feeding cables. That way, resistance of both cables and clamps is almost completely excluded from the resistance measurement.





Remote Control Unit

The RMO Remote Control Unit is an optional control unit that is used to start and stop the tests from a remote location, away from the actual RMO. Provided that, for a series of tests, the same test current is fed through the test object, multiple measurements can be carried out with the RMO Remote Control Unit.

Current clamp meter

Using the micro-ohmmeter RMO600 with current clamp meter it is possible to make safer measurement of breakers with both sides of the breaker grounded. It is performed by measuring the current through the ground connection and reducing this value from the total current.

Technical data

 
1 Mains Power Supply  
- Connection according to IEC/EN60320-1; UL498, CSA 22.2
- Mains supply from 90 to 264V AC; 50-60Hz
2 Output data  
- Test current 5A - 600A DC
- Measuring range Resolution
   0,1µΩ - 999,9µΩ 0,1µΩ
   1,000mΩ - 9,999mΩ 1µΩ
   10,00mΩ - 99,99mΩ 10µΩ
   100,0mΩ - 999,9mΩ 0,1mΩ
- Typical accuracy ±(0,25% rdg + 0,25% FS)
3 Environment conditions
- Operating temperature -10°C - +50°C / 14°F - +122°F
- Storage and transportation -25°C - +70°C / -13°F - +158°F
- Humidity 5% - 95% relative humidity, non condensing
4 Dimensions and Weight
- Dimensions 198 x 255 x 380mm
7,8 x 10 x 15 in.
(A x A x F) without handle
- Weight 8, 0 kg/17,5 lb
5 Mechanical protection IP54
6 Warranty Two years
